What is Pathfinder Bancorp's occupancy and equipment?
Pathfinder Bancorp (PBHC) reported occupancy and equipment of $1.33M in Q1 2026.
How has Pathfinder Bancorp's occupancy and equipment changed year-over-year?
Pathfinder Bancorp's occupancy and equipment decreased by 1.5% year-over-year, from $1.35M to $1.33M.
What is the long-term trend for Pathfinder Bancorp's occupancy and equipment?
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Pathfinder Bancorp's occupancy and equipment has grown at a 14.2%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$3.12M to $5.31M.
What does occupancy and equipment mean?
Costs for office and branch facilities (rent, utilities, maintenance) and equipment (depreciation, repairs, technology hardware) used in operations.
